# Spread

## 1. Definition

**Spread** is the difference between the Ask price (Buy price) and the Bid price (Sell price) of an instrument at a specific moment.

Spread represents the immediate transaction cost paid by the client when opening a position.

## 2. Formula  


[![Screenshot 2026-03-02 at 14.18.36.png](https://wiki.wi.services/uploads/images/gallery/2026-03/scaled-1680-/screenshot-2026-03-02-at-14-18-36.png)](https://wiki.wi.services/uploads/images/gallery/2026-03/screenshot-2026-03-02-at-14-18-36.png)

```
Spread = Ask - Bid
```

Where:

- **Ask** — price displayed in the Buy button
- **Bid** — price displayed in the Sell button

## 3. Example  


[![image.png](https://wiki.wi.services/uploads/images/gallery/2026-03/scaled-1680-/DoMimage.png)](https://wiki.wi.services/uploads/images/gallery/2026-03/DoMimage.png)

Spread is measured in the **instrument price unit**.

For instruments quoted against USD (e.g. USOUSD, WTI, BRENT, BTCUSD):

```
Unit = USD
```

Example:

```
Ask = 72.68
Bid = 72.36

Spread = 72.68 - 72.36 = 0.32
```

Result: **0.32 USD**
